Navigating Heartbreak: The Struggle Between Love and Friendship

'Amigo Da Minha Saudade', by Henrique e Juliano, is a song that lays bare the pain of a breakup in a sincere and visceral way, exploring the boundary between intense love and the struggle to let go of someone who still holds a place in the heart. The lyrical narrative is marked by the rejection of the idea of turning a profound love into something as superficial as friendship, highlighting the emotional weight that the past carries.

The chorus, which repeats the inability to 'flip the switch' from love to friendship, reveals the intensity of the emotions experienced. More than just a breakup, the ending here becomes an internal struggle: how do you move forward when longing lingers as an almost physical presence? The repetition of 'I loved too much' amplifies the outburst, as if the narrator is trying to reaffirm to themselves the depth of their pain and truth.

The choice of direct, at times even raw, language, as in 'To hell with friendship', adds authenticity to the song, making it even more relatable to the audience. It expresses the less romantic side of love: one of hurt, resistance, and difficulty in accepting change. This emotional honesty is what makes the song so moving, as it conveys a universal experience of loss and overcoming.

Ultimately, 'Amigo Da Minha Saudade' is a cry from someone who still loves but understands they need to distance themselves to survive the pain. It’s a portrayal of how love, even in farewell, can be so powerful that it defies being reduced to something lesser.
